Description

This form of deed conveys an interest in minerals, as a gift. In States, such as Texas, recognizing community property, a gift deed creates separate property in the grantee.

Essential Elements of a Valid Deed Competent parties: grantor and grantee. Words of grant or operative words of conveyance. Sufficient description of the property to be conveyed. Proper execution.

If the trial court finds the grantor intended the deed to take effect at some point in the future, or if the trial court finds the grantor thought the deed would not be effective until some subsequent act was performed, then there was no delivery and the deed is void and ineffective.

The DC recorder of deeds requires two forms when recording deeds: Real Property Recordation and Tax Form FP-7/C. Form FP-7/C is a return form listing details about the transfer?including the amount of consideration. The current owner and new owner must both sign the form.

Words of conveyance is a stipulation in a deed demonstrating the definite intent to convey a specific title to real property to a named grantee.

A Washington, DC, deed must identify by name the current owner (the grantor) transferring the property and the new owner (the grantee) receiving it. Party addresses. A deed should include the new owner's address. DC law does not strictly require the current owner's address, but it is often included.

While recording a deed does not affect its validity, it is extremely important to record since recordation protects the grantee. If a grantee fails to record, and another deed or any other document encumbering or affecting the title is recorded, the first grantee is in jeopardy.
